Haven Private LLC acquired a new stake in shares of Franklin Electric Co., Inc. (NASDAQ:FELE - Free Report) during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The firm acquired 4,814 shares of the industrial products company's stock, valued at approximately $469,000.
A number of other hedge funds have also recently bought and sold shares of FELE. Spire Wealth Management bought a new position in shares of Franklin Electric in the fourth quarter valued at approximately $29,000. Trust Co. of Vermont bought a new position in Franklin Electric in the 4th quarter valued at $40,000. Blue Trust Inc. increased its position in shares of Franklin Electric by 66.2% during the 4th quarter. Blue Trust Inc. now owns 497 shares of the industrial products company's stock valued at $52,000 after purchasing an additional 198 shares during the last quarter. Smartleaf Asset Management LLC increased its position in shares of Franklin Electric by 189.2% during the 4th quarter. Smartleaf Asset Management LLC now owns 642 shares of the industrial products company's stock valued at $62,000 after purchasing an additional 420 shares during the last quarter. Finally, Point72 DIFC Ltd bought a new stake in shares of Franklin Electric during the 3rd quarter worth $77,000. 79.98% of the stock is owned by hedge funds and other institutional investors.
Franklin Electric Stock Performance
FELE traded up $0.28 during trading on Tuesday, hitting $100.78. 262,884 shares of the company traded hands, compared to its average volume of 208,345. The firm has a market cap of $4.61 billion, a P/E ratio of 26.18,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.11 and a beta of 0.98. The company has a quick ratio of 1.06, a current ratio of 2.22 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.01. Franklin Electric Co., Inc. has a one year low of $91.67 and a one year high of $111.94. The stock's fifty day moving average is $99.77 and its 200 day moving average is $101.97.
Franklin Electric (NASDAQ:FELE -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Tuesday, February 18th. The industrial products company reported $0.72 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$0.69 by $0.03. The firm had revenue of $485.75 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$465.87 million. Franklin Electric had a net margin of 8.92% and a return on equity of 14.46%. As a group, equities analysts predict that Franklin Electric Co., Inc. will post 4.19 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Franklin Electric Increases Dividend
The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, February 20th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, February 6th were issued a dividend of $0.265 per share. This is a boost from Franklin Electric's previous quarterly dividend of $0.25. The ex-dividend date was Thursday, February 6th. This represents a $1.06 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 1.05%. Franklin Electric's payout ratio is presently 27.53%.

Franklin Electric Co,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, designs, manufactures, and distributes water and fuel pumping systems worldwide. The company operates through Water Systems, Fueling Systems, and Distribution segments. The Water Systems segment offers submersible motors, drives, pumps, electronic controls, water treatment systems, monitoring devices, and related parts and equipment.
